What Causes Canker Sores Every Time After Kissing?
My boyfriend always gets canker sores after he kisses me. I have not had any sexual encounters with anyone but him. We are both clean from STD s or STI s. I have had gastritis for some time while being with him, but it has since then left and I do not have it anymore. Is there a problem with me or him and what is the problem? thank you

canker sore is not a sexually transmitted diseases not it transmit via kissing. the problem is with your boy friend. may be due to his deficiency in some of the nutrients. ask him to take a diet rich in green leafy vegetables and fruits and milk and also taking egg will help.
for the ulcer can use gel of benzocane which will be available with the dentists. Or he can take vitamin B complex tablets along with seacod capsules once a day for 2 weeks.
